摘要
Reactions of a sterically demanding cyclic (alkyl)(amino)carbene (CAAC) with FeCl2(thf)(1.5), CoBr2, and NiBr2(dme) afforded the complexes [FeCl(-Cl)(CAAC)](2) (1), [CoBr(-Br)(CAAC)](2) (2), and [NiBr(-Br)(CAAC)](2) (3) in moderate yields. Compounds 1-3 were characterized by X-ray crystallography, H-1 NMR, and UV/Vis spectroscopy. Dimeric, halide-bridged structures were observed in the solid state, in which the metal atoms are coordinated in a distorted tetrahedral fashion by the CAAC and three halide ligands. The solution magnetic moments in THF and dichloromethane indicate a high-spin electronic configuration.
